Bibiani Gold Stars delivered a hard-fought performance to claim a 1-0 victory over Berekum Chelsea in today’s outstanding Ghana Premier League match at Dun’s Park.
Bibiani Gold Stars, spurred on by their home crowd, broke the deadlock in the 42nd minute through a clinical strike from Samuel Atta Kumi, who ultimately earned the Man of the Match accolade. Despite strong resistance from Berekum Chelsea, Bibiani's defense held firm, ensuring they secured all three points.
With this win, Bibiani Gold Stars continue to build momentum in the league and now set their sights on their next league clash against the formidable Hearts of Oak, who have won three in five games.
Meanwhile, Berekum Chelsea will aim to bounce back when they face Young Apostles FC in their upcoming fixture. The atmosphere at Dun’s Park reflected the club’s growing belief and the excitement around their recent run of form, keeping fans hopeful for further successes this season
